1 definition by Lemon wedge

Refering to the "cats meow". Richest, Glamourous, Prettiest..Along the lines of being almost perfect. Must have attitude, money, fame, fortune, a nice car, looks. Finicky, rude, but all together worshiped and envied.
Waiter: Would you like some of our finest champange miss?

A-list: Nah, do you think you could send someone to italy to pick up my favourite drink?

by Lemon wedge April 15, 2006